On Java 8, constructing a second Fory instance in the same JVM fails, once an earlier
instance has serialized an object graph large enough to trigger JIT codegen. The failure comes
from ClassResolver.initialize() while registering Fory's own built-in types — the string
it fails to encode is the package or type name of a Fory internal class, which is ASCII by
construction.
A single Fory instance never fails, at any payload size (checked to ~3.3 MB / 150k objects),
so this is not a serialization-size problem. Once it throws, every later Fory construction in
that JVM fails the same way.
The practical impact is on any application holding more than one Fory — two library modules
that each keep a static instance, or one instance per classloader in a container. The second
can become permanently un-constructible depending on what the first happened to serialize.

What did you expect to see?
OK items=800 instances=4 bytes=194341
What did you see instead?
10 of 10 runs fail on Java 8; 0 of 10 on Java 21.
FAIL at instance 2 of 4 (items=800, bytes=194341): java.lang.IllegalArgumentException: Non-ASCII characters in meta string are not allowed
java.lang.IllegalArgumentException: Non-ASCII characters in meta string are not allowed
at org.apache.fory.meta.MetaStringEncoder.encodeBinary(MetaStringEncoder.java:92)
at org.apache.fory.resolver.SharedRegistry.getEncodedMetaString(SharedRegistry.java:337)
at org.apache.fory.resolver.SharedRegistry.getPackageEncodedMetaString(SharedRegistry.java:309)
at org.apache.fory.resolver.TypeInfo.<init>(TypeInfo.java:106)
at org.apache.fory.resolver.ClassResolver.registerInternalImpl(ClassResolver.java:728)
at org.apache.fory.resolver.ClassResolver.registerInternal(ClassResolver.java:716)
at org.apache.fory.resolver.ClassResolver.initialize(ClassResolver.java:273)
at org.apache.fory.Fory.<init>(Fory.java:155)
at org.apache.fory.config.ForyBuilder.newFory(ForyBuilder.java:789)
at org.apache.fory.ThreadLocalFory.newFory(ThreadLocalFory.java:67)
Variations across runs of the same command, all with the above root cause:
- it also fails via getTypeNameEncodedMetaString (SharedRegistry.java:317), so either meta
string can be the one that fails;
- on 1.7.0 it is sometimes surfaced wrapped, as
org.apache.fory.exception.SerializationException: java.lang.RuntimeException: Create sequential serializer failed
(7/10 raw, 3/10 wrapped in one sample of 10);
- the failing instance index is usually 2, occasionally 3.
Results, 10 runs per cell:
fory items instances Java 8 Java 21
1.6.1 800 4 10/10 fail 0/10
1.7.0 800 4 10/10 fail 0/10
1.6.1 800 1 0/10 0/10

Conditions, each verified by removing it:
- Java 8. Not reproducible on Java 21, including at 8 instances and 4x the payload.
- More than one Fory instance constructed in the JVM.
- An earlier serialization large enough to trigger JIT codegen. Built-in types alone never
trigger it. A flat HashMap<Integer, UserType> of 6000 entries does NOT reproduce; several
distinct generic shapes (Map<Integer,.>, Map<Long,.>, Set) do. It is not a simple
size threshold — the same shape reproduces at 2000 entries per field but not at 10000.
- withRefTracking(true).
The failure rate tracks how many builder methods are called. With withLanguage +
requireClassRegistration(false) + withRefTracking(true) alone it reproduces intermittently;
adding further builder calls raises the rate (8 runs each, Java 8; reproduce each row with the
third arg, e.g. ... ForyMultiInstanceRepro 800 4 min):
builder config arg fail rate
minimal (above) min 2/8
- withRefCopy(true) copy 2/8
- serializeEnumByName(true) enum 6/8
- withNumberCompressed(false) num 7/8
- withRefCopy(true) + withNumberCompressed(false) copy+num 8/8
serializeEnumByName(true) raises the rate although the payload contains no enums, and
withRefCopy(true) affects only copy(), which is never called here. That suggests the trigger is
sensitive to the number of action-recording builder methods replayed in ForyBuilder.factory(),
rather than to any single option's semantics.
withCodegen(false) and withAsyncCompilation(true) each reduce the rate without eliminating it,
so neither is a workaround.
Ruled out:
- A shared SharedRegistry instance. Fory.(builder, classLoader, sharedRegistry) does
new SharedRegistry() when the argument is null, so separate instances do not share one.
- The isLatin/ASCII range gap. StringEncodingUtils.isLatin(char[]) accepts chars <= 255 while
the LOWER_SPECIAL encoders reject > 127, but encodeBinary(String, Encoding[]) correctly
falls back to UTF-8 — verified with "café", "aÿ", "aĀ", "a中" on both JDKs.
The gap applies only to the forced-encoding overload, which is what this path uses.
- The multi-release jar. PlatformStringUtils and MemoryBuffer are overridden only under
META-INF/versions/25/, so Java 8 and Java 21 both load the base classes.

Suggested hardening, independent of root cause:
MetaStringEncoder.encodeBinary(String, Encoding) throws when the forced encoding cannot
represent the string, while the Encoding[] overload falls back to UTF-8. Making the
forced-encoding path fall back the same way would downgrade this from an error that permanently
prevents Fory construction in the JVM to correct (if slightly larger) output.
